Who We Are:
Impala Canada is the only Canadian pure play palladium producer. Located in Northern Ontario, Lac des Iles Mine (LDI) features a world class orebody consisting of an open pit and one of the largest underground mines in Canada. Mine operations are data driven, supported by the latest in mine technology and equipment, real time mine management, and automation. At LDI we employ over 700 of Canada's best and brightest in their field. Driven to exceed, our people are motivated by a culture of safety in a positive and collaborative work environment. With a modern infrastructure, significant exploration portfolio, and dedicated employees Impala Canada is a well-positioned, low cost, long term, sustainable palladium producer.
Job Description:
The successful applicant will be reporting to the Mining Manager and will be responsible for all underground operations. This position is responsible for providing direction and managing health and safety, manpower issues, costs, and productivity while executing the 3 month and Life of Mine Plan. The schedule for this position is eight (8) days on and six (6) days off.
Qualifications:
The ideal applicant will possess a minimum of 20 years' experience in mine operations, with 3 to 5 years as a General Foreman underground. Previous experience and technical experience of longhole/blasthole mining methods would be highly regarded.
The applicant must possess Ontario Common Core modules for underground hard rock mining and Ontario Supervisory Common Core. Any post-secondary education, namely an Engineering degree or college diploma in Mining would be an asset, but not a prerequisite.
